Severe Thunderstorms, Tornado Warnings Across North Texas

Courtesy of the National Weather Service

NORTH TEXAS  (WBAP/KLIF News) – Severe thunderstorms swept through parts of North Texas overnight bringing heavy rains, high winds and tornado warnings Wednesday morning.

Oncor reported that the storm knocked out power to more than 200,000 customers.

The company’s Geoff Bailey said crews are working as safely and diligently to restore power as quickly as possible.

The storms moved in just after midnight, after a squall line of severe storms raked across North Texas.

The National Weather Service issued Severe Thunderstorm Warning for numerous counties including Dallas, Tarrant, Hunt, Eastern Kaufman and Van Zandt counties.

One person was reportedly injured in Rockwall but reports of wind damage to homes and business are extensive.
